Discover cheap things to do in Guayaquil
Guayaquil, the bustling heart of Ecuador, offers a plethora of budget-friendly activities for travellers seeking both adventure and culture. Start your exploration at the iconic Malecón 2000, a vibrant riverside promenade where you can enjoy the stunning views of the Guayas River while wandering through lush gardens and open-air markets — all for free! Just a stone's throw away, the historic Las Peñas neighbourhood invites you to climb its colourful steps, leading to the Santa Ana Hill, where the panoramic views at the top are simply breathtaking and won't cost you a penny. For those interested in wildlife, a visit to the Parque Histórico is a must; here, you can observe native animals and enjoy the beautiful historic architecture at no charge. If you're keen on local cuisine without breaking the bank, head to Mercado del Sur for delicious, affordable street food, from fresh ceviche to hearty empanadas, all prepared in the lively atmosphere of a local market.
